Capitals to host viewing party at Capital One Arena for Game 4 vs. Hurricanes

During last year’s Stanley Cup Playoffs, the Washington Capitals started hosting viewing parties at Capital One Arena for road games as they advanced further in the postseason.

Now, they’re back.

The Capitals announced Wednesday that fans can watch Thursday’s Game 4 against the Carolina Hurricanes at Capital One Arena — for free.

Doors will open at 6:30 p.m. for the game’s 7 p.m. start, which will be broadcast on the jumbotron. Fans should use the F Street entrance to gain admission.

Per the team, beer will also be $5 from 6:30-7 p.m.
